Hello, I have enjoyed reading your comments, suggestions, and jokes. I want to know if anyone suffers the way I do? I was diagnosed with ulcerative colitis 2 years ago. No one in family has had this. I try not to complain because I only have episodes 1x a year. Normally last 2 weeks, go away and I can then do whatever I want. Well, this time, 5 weeks, extreme pain..the whole works. Can't eat much, starving every 2 hours, have to go to bathroom every 1/2 hour to hour. Someone said they were afraid to eat, but I am afraid to leave my house. I have to time it just right to leave(doesn't always work) I know where every bathroom is in the city. I keep liners,underwear, soap and lysol with me. Go to work late so I don't sit in traffic. I take Metamucil but I don't have gas. I have lost 10lbs. I have been taken Bifidus and Acidophilus herbs. They have taken the "sharp" pain away. My doctor told me "as long as u take Asacol, u can eat whatever u want" BullS!!! Do alot of u suffer everyday? or like me? I am sorry to vent, but no one else around me knows exactly what I am going through..Thanks for listening.... What can I eat while I am having an episode? I have been eating turkey on sourdough bread, baked chix, string beans, potatos, metamucil, water. Those r the only things I know. Please help...
